Salam & Welcome to Yalla, Let’s Heal! Are you navigating the push & pull of identity & belonging? Host Isabella Kanso – a Lebanese-Canadian war survivor & refugee – dives into the conversations that help us heal & belong. In each episode, she unpacks the experiences of living between worlds, breaking generational traumas, & building bridges of belonging. So whether you’re an immigrant, part of the diaspora, or someone who feels they don’t quite fit in, Yalla, Let’s Heal is here to be that space for you in the world. #7 Unveiling the Veil: Embracing Identity & Authenticity

In this captivating podcast conversation, Dr. Aisha, the erudite founder and CEO of Minds Rewired, expounds upon her multifaceted roles and her lofty mission to endow individuals with hope and the freedom to choose. With an illustrious background as a medical scientist, she embarks on a profoundly personal odyssey of self-discovery and rejuvenation.


Dr. Aisha delves into the arduous quest for self-identity, grappling with the depths of subconscious beliefs, and surmounting formidable obstacles. Through her erudition, she highlights the paramount significance of self-awareness, the profound act of introspection, and the unwavering pursuit of personal growth.


This heartfelt tête-à-tête also underscores the imperativeness of healing dialogues and the embracing of one's distinctive qualities and blessings as immigrants and refugees. Dr. Aisha ardently advocates for a paradigm shift from a purely physical vantage point to a spiritually enlightened perspective, thereby fostering constructive contributions to the collective well-being of humanity.


The discourse culminates with an enlightening anecdote, wherein Dr. Aisha extols the virtues of treating our parents with reverence and acknowledging their selfless sacrifices. She advises a conscientious understanding of our parents' backgrounds, struggles, and their personal healing journeys; advocating for open dialogues that address hurtful behaviors, all while affording our parents the opportunity to share their invaluable perspectives. Commencing the healing process within ourselves through a meticulous examination of our belief systems and reactive patterns becomes an indispensable cornerstone.


The conversation further delves into the pernicious effects of disparaging comments, and unrelenting criticism rampant in the realm of social media. The deleterious impact of such hurtful messages is thoroughly acknowledged, as they can precipitate demotivation and instill seeds of self-doubt. Dr. Aisha, our esteemed guest, imparts wisdom on fortifying our mental resilience, recognizing the inherent toxicity of the digital domain.


Delving into their own vulnerable encounters, they traverse the jagged terrain of coping with hurtful comments, proffering a repertoire of alternative approaches, including responding with unwavering love and understanding. This remarkable dialogue shines a light on the dissonance between individuals' online personas and their authentic selves, underscoring the insidious loneliness and precarious mental health challenges engendered by an undue reliance on social media for validation. The conversation astutely examines the societal and cultural pressures to conform and appease others, while underscoring the paramount importance of remaining true to one's essence.


Indeed, an urgent call resounds to peel back the facade woven by social media and live a life steeped in authenticity, guided by the unique trajectory of our own journeys, refusing to succumb to the clutches of others' opinions. The guest eloquently espouses the significance of drawing strength from within, nurturing a spiritual connection, and recognizing that rejection is an inevitable facet of life that bears no testament to one's inherent worth. The dialogue concludes by urging listeners to redirect their gaze from external validation, instead discovering solace and confidence in their own purpose and their profound potential to affect positive change in the world.
